One previous study has reported a nominally significant association between a SNP in the TERT region (rs2736122) and endometrial cancer (reported P = 0.03) (Prescott et al. 2010 ), but this SNP was not significant in our larger analysis ( P = 0.85; Supplementary Table 5), whilst a recent multi-cancer study of nearly 2,000 5p15.33 SNPs did not report an association with endometrial cancer (Wang et al. 2014 ).
